The last days I worked a lot on Meet Mat base (and details) that I textured like the head, because I wanted to balance all the colors and patterns of the model to make a sense of harmony and elegance when I look at it. 


Update - 16 Jan 2024

Here some textures that I used to recreate the glowing and sparkling effect you can see "under" the displacement

I started working on the head's shape because I wanted a realistic "crystal geode" effect: crystals are broken or chipped in some parts and they have also like "rocky cracks" that I tried to ricreate all around the head. 

I liked so much the crystal that shines and comes out of the rock!!


Update - 15 Jan 2024

The second day I found out a texture that could be perfect for my concept, something like realistic stone-cracks. So I decided to add a shiny texture to see if it worked and I liked it 'cause the effect reminded me of an Opal Stone (so I was getting closer to my aim)

I kept on experimenting with glittered/shiny textures and I started to work with the displacement for my first time. At the beginning it was not easy because, as I said, I didn't know how to get the result that I wanted, so It was like a flow of attempts until one night something like magic happened 'cause I managed to create the perfect crystal effect for my Meet Mat... This is my first update for the Meet Mat contest. This is a 27/12/23 screenshot, I started working on it during Christmas holidays. In my mind I wanted to create something like a realistic, shiny, and colourful crystal (they are my passion). So, first of all, I've searched on the internet some similar work because it's only my first time with displacement and my third time with SP and I had no idea about what to do... But (surprise) I didn't find anything like that (sadly there were only tutorials about ice and marble). So I started to do by myself, during the following nights I had a lot of fun playing with displacement. Here you can see how, the first day, I tried to recreate the cracks and veins that crystals have, but it was too much 'marble-like' and it was not what I wanted for my shiny crystal Meet Mat.
